Iselin Park in Aspen offers a serene and picturesque setting for walkers and runners to enjoy. Nestled in the heart of the city, this 8.4-acre park provides a peaceful ambiance with its lush greenery and tranquil pathways, making it an ideal escape for those seeking a refreshing outdoor experience. Whether you're a seasoned hiker or a casual walker, Iselin Park's natural beauty and well-maintained trails make it a delightful destination for outdoor enthusiasts. Visitors to Iselin Park can engage in a variety of activities, including walking, running, and hiking. The park's well-designed paths cater to all fitness levels, offering both leisurely strolls and more challenging routes for those seeking an active adventure. Aspen's typical climate, characterized by crisp mountain air and abundant sunshine, provides the perfect backdrop for outdoor activities, making Iselin Park a year-round haven for walkers and runners alike. FAQs About Iselin Park

Are there facilities or amenities for walkers/runners in Iselin Park?

Yes, Iselin Park offers facilities for walkers and runners, including tennis courts and a baseball court where you can run or do sports.

How accessible is Iselin Park?

Iselin Park is easily accessible, with well-maintained paths and open spaces that are ideal for walking and running.

What kind of sports can I do in Iselin Park?

In Iselin Park, you can enjoy playing tennis or baseball, which are great options for staying active and fit while enjoying the outdoors.

What is the best season to walk in Iselin Park?

The best season to walk in Iselin Park is typically late spring to early fall when the weather is mild and the park is lush and green.

What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Iselin Park?

In Iselin Park, you should prepare for cool to warm temperatures with occasional rain showers, especially in the summer months. Winter can bring snow and cold temperatures.

What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Iselin Park?

In Iselin Park, you may encounter various wildlife such as deer, squirrels, birds, and occasionally foxes. It's important to be mindful and respectful of the natural habitat while enjoying the park.
